The video tutorial covers key equations related to elasticity, including the relationship between force, spring constant, and extension. It explains elastic potential energy and how energy is transferred when a spring is stretched. Through practical examples, the tutorial demonstrates how to calculate the spring constant and elastic potential energy. It also discusses the graphical representation of force against extension, highlighting the elastic limit and Hooke's Law.
